Taking from the poor to give to the mall

Mike Kaszuba in the Star Tribune reports that Mall of America lobbyists are once again seeking public funding for the mall's phase 2. The new proposal, perhaps the most disgusting yet, would take money from the Metropolitan Fiscal Disparities program--a revolutionary tax-base sharing program that helps to diminish the gap between wealthy and poor cities in the Twin Cities metro. This is not a "gray" issue -- taking funds from this pool to fund a mall would be morally bankrupt and inexcusable.

Mall officials say that, without subsidies, the second phase of the mall won't happen. So what? It's too big as it is already. Why should the poorest cities in the region subsidize a giant mall that can't pay for itself?
